Abstract
15 alkyl nitrites were studied in the gaseous state in the infrared between 2 and 24 μ. The O‐N=O group is characterized by a very strong absorption in the 3 regions 1660,800 and 600 cm−1, corresponding to the N=O stretching, N‐O stretching and O‐N=O bending frequencies respectively. Rotational isomerism, already observed in methyl nitrite, appears to be a general property of organic nitrites.The influence of length, shape and kind of the carbon chain on the frequencies and intensities of the characteristic bands has been studied. Application to the diagnosis of primary, secondary or tertiary alcohols is suggested.
